Short Interest in Innovator U.S. Small Cap Power Buffer ETF – September (BATS:KSEP) Rises By 100.0%

Innovator U.S. Small Cap Power Buffer ETF – September (BATS:KSEPGet Free Report) was the recipient of a significant increase in short interest during the month of June. As of June 15th, there was short interest totaling 550 shares, an increase of 100.0% from the May 31st total of 275 shares. Based on an average trading volume of 3,237 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 0.2 days. Approximately 0.1% of the shares of the company are sold short.

About Innovator U.S. Small Cap Power Buffer ETF – September

The Innovator U.S. Small Cap Power Buffer ETF – September (KSEP)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in small-cap stocks. The fund aims to participate in the price movement of the iShares Russell 2000 ETF, up to a predetermined cap, while buffering the first 15% of losses over a one-year period. The fund is actively managed, using FLEX options and collateral to provide exposure. KSEP was launched on Aug 31, 2024 and is issued by Innovator.
